Within the southern areas of Maine, similar to York and Cumberland counties, winters are sometimes milder, with common temperatures starting from 24°F to 40°F (-4°C to 4°C). Snowfall is average, with a mean of 12-18 inches (30-45 cm) alongside coastal areas. These areas are much less vulnerable to excessive chilly snaps and snow storms, making them a beautiful vacation spot for vacationers.

Regional Contrasts: Winter Climate in Northern and Coastal Maine

In distinction, northern Maine, together with Aroostook and Penobscot counties, experiences a lot colder temperatures, with common lows starting from -2°F to twenty°F (-19°C to -7°C). This area receives considerably extra snow, with a mean of 30-40 inches (76-102 cm) in areas like Houlton and Caribou. Coastal areas, similar to Bar Harbor and Boothbay Harbor, additionally obtain ample snowfall, with averages starting from 20-30 inches (50-76 cm).

Maine’s Snowmobile Trails

Snowmobile trails are a significant a part of Maine’s winter recreation scene. With over 13,000 miles of trails spanning throughout the state, snowmobile lovers can discover the attractive Maine wilderness. Snowmobiles contribute considerably to Maine’s financial system, producing income and creating jobs for native residents.

Preparation and Response to Extreme Winter Climate Situations

The Maine Division of Transportation (DOT) and Emergency Administration are well-equipped to deal with extreme winter climate situations. Here is how they put together and reply:

  1. The DOT pre-treats roads with salt and sand to stop ice formation.
  2. The DOT deploys plows and different tools to clear roads as rapidly as doable.
  3. The Emergency Administration Company (EMA) displays climate situations and coordinates with native authorities to answer emergencies.

These efforts assist preserve Maine’s roads and communities secure in the course of the winter months.
